Type
ORACLE
Validation date
2024-11-13 00:42: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01524,
    "usd": 0.01617
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000100368497D933325C34EFAEFB02C79BFDD4BBF4B4BA80C583C96828088B4047D7

Previous signature

664595DFC6C95089631086E3A466E662A3804118053F0780A874437966B55594C8255EC9BD229E23BD36F68102EEDD7595E6F93094B74F513E57B017633B7B0C

Origin signature

3045022100CA32F5480C852C710297EE5AE362C84501F2A0B075362A3CA61E8BB1B0D533BD0220694A228781DDF47AE31FB4C752BC19ED032055A9272A3DB0B0D858188E901E41

Proof of work

010204480DD0A3F06534B4F9B9D93AC3BCC7EA8437BAE24295DBCB92035EE4E5C7AC86DE42699A2F1481F9F892D528363680AF126B34DADED27CFC5CF4F778B7027D14

Proof of integrity

00DD42C33F61F3E0421B3D1A4FB28ADAABC6E47A66275D88D7CC2E22D6E0D6FCDD

Coordinator signature

77C3522C6953C204AFE8D44F93A8676696B1C30D9094B8E3DC94484DFBEFB1143294DC3B1729067EA8B4BE2AEEA30D08C157EEC261DD4AB174D0B1FC602D840B

Validator #1 public key

0001AC6CA4DFE26954F8C8FB58EAED07DEDA6D0A6DAA84085CEA5607892BE39F541F

Validator #1 signature

3A55F7D9774A5939BDF13FD67C179EF389846827705676A134CF546B500898CBA1EA1EEB3701633782701EBD33296802086B7B0DD8C9D78D056554B41E825D0A

Validator #2 public key

0001A5F6705AFE5C9103B4BE3307F94B3EC386283B77ABAA1D39C423EA4D6597F989

Validator #2 signature

75AEEDB3A349604811101F11E00D5C30DD3025A8BAC4A097300EAD444D33704A04B77C742B047A421AF95AF9B6F308504F2679DD7EFDDD92FD6CC45D3AA53301